There are few things more important for us to deal with than the health and safety of our men and women in uniform. For everything they do, for all the courage they've shown and the sacrifices that they've made, we must be absolutely vigilant about protecting them from unnecessary risk. That's why I was troubled to hear news reports about several of our most highly trained and skilled Air Force pilots experiencing loss of oxygen while in the cockpit of the F 22 aircraft. We're talking about blacking out, losing control of the plane, and suffering memory loss. In fact, 18 percent of those who flew the F 22 reported an incident similar to this. In fact, one family blames this mysterious affliction for a crash that killed their loved one. We have some of our most fearless pilots afraid and even refusing to take the controls of the F 22. Two pilots went so far as to appear on shows like ``60 Minutes'' without permission from their superiors so that they could expose the problem. In response, Madam Speaker, I prepared an amendment to the National Defense Authorization Act, which the House will debate today. My amendment would cut off funding for the F 22 until the Pentagon inspector general completes an investigation on these malfunctions and finds a solution to protect the safety of our pilots.…
